+#define CLX_DATA(irated, num_phases, clx_path, extd_intf) \
+       ((extd_intf << 29) |                              \
+        (clx_path << 28) |                               \
+        (num_phases << 22) |                             \
+        (irated << 16))
+
+struct a6xx_hfi_clx_domain_v2 {
+       /**
+        * @data: BITS[0:15]  Migration time
+        *        BITS[16:21] Current rating
+        *        BITS[22:27] Phases for domain
+        *        BITS[28:28] Path notification
+        *        BITS[29:31] Extra features
+        */
+       u32 data;
+       /** @clxt: CLX time in microseconds */
+       u32 clxt;
+       /** @clxh: CLH time in microseconds */
+       u32 clxh;
+       /** @urg_mode: Urgent HW throttle mode of operation */
+       u32 urg_mode;
+       /** @lkg_en: Enable leakage current estimate */
+       u32 lkg_en;
+       /** curr_budget: Current Budget */
+       u32 curr_budget;
+} __packed;
+
+#define HFI_H2F_MSG_CLX_TBL 8
+
+#define MAX_CLX_DOMAINS 2
+struct a6xx_hfi_clx_table_v2_cmd {
+       u32 hdr;
+       u32 version;
+       struct a6xx_hfi_clx_domain_v2 domain[MAX_CLX_DOMAINS];
+} __packed;
